What they do

An Ethnic or Cultural Studies Professor leads courses pertaining to the culture and development of an area, an ethnic group, or any other group, such as Latin American studies, women's studies, or urban affairs. Includes both teachers primarily engaged in teaching and those who do a combination of teaching and research.

Harvard Divinity School Position Description Harvard University's Faculty of Divinity seeks to appoint a full-time tenured or tenure-track faculty member in World Christianity. The Professorship will be awarded to an outstanding scholar whose research and teaching focus primarily on Christianity's growth, transformation, and significance as viewed globally and through the lens of specific regions. We welcome applications from candidates who combine a strong training in the study of Christianity with linguistic and historical competence in one or more geographical settings-including, but not limited to, Africa, Asia, Oceania, Latin America, and the Caribbean-from the nineteenth century to the present. Methodological approach is open. Successful candidates should be prepared to teach courses that reflect the diversity of Christianity in the world today. Basic Qualifications Applicants should be competent in the appropriate research languages and be able to teach and advise at the doctoral and master's levels. The successful candidate will work closely with students in the Divinity School's Master of Divinity, Master of Theological Studies, and Master of Religion in Public Life programs, as well as PhD candidates in the Study of Religion in the Graduate School of Arts and Sciences. They will also have an opportunity to teach undergraduates in Harvard College and to collaborate with colleagues and students in other departments and schools in the University.
